The three things worth knowing before reading the diff: RBAC WAS ALREADY BUILT. docs/build-plan.md marks F2 and F3 outstanding and is stale — packages/core/src/permissions.ts and lib/mutation.ts shipped long ago. So this does not rebuild them; it closes the gaps an audit found. The big one is that reads were entirely ungoverned: every GET was "any authenticated member", so a junior demand rep and a research contractor could both pull per-block supplier cost and break-even prices from /api/capacity/margin, and every contract's negotiated terms. For a company whose margin is the business, that was the hole that mattered. Adds book:read / economics:read / team:read, a readGuard middleware, and a `viewer` role below member. THE BUTTON AND THE 403 DISAGREED — the exact thing F3 said must never happen. Contracts.tsx never called can() at all, so its save button was always enabled against a server requiring contract:sign; Capacity.tsx gated commitment creation on deal:write/demand while the server wanted commitment:write/supply. POST /api/activities was the one write bypassing executeMutation: no capability check, and any member could mutate accounts.lastActivityAt as a side effect. It is now a proper mutation() behind activity:write. Calendar is a projection over thirteen dated sources rather than a new table, because a table would duplicate dates that already live on contracts, deals and commitments and would drift — and one ledger answering the question is the whole argument. It surfaces export_authorizations and compliance_artifacts, which had indexed expires_at columns, schema comments saying they must be alerted on, and no read endpoint or UI anywhere. Learn carries two tracks. Concepts are members-only; the platform track can be opened with a share code by someone with no account. The code mints a scoped learn-only token and never a Principal — every route here resolves a principal and then checks capabilities, so a principal-minting code would be one missing check away from leaking the book. "Only platform-track rows may be code-visible" is a database CHECK constraint as well as a write-path rule, and a test asserts a valid learn token still gets 401 on /api/dashboard, /api/accounts and /api/contracts — the same invariant scripts/deploy.sh refuses to ship without. CD becomes tag-to-ship. CI publishes an image to the Gitea registry on a release-* tag and cloud-2 pulls it, so no credential on the shared runner can execute anything on production — by construction rather than by policy. Both halves of deploy.sh's original rule survive: nothing on the runner reaches the host, and a human still decides when it ships. deploy.sh gains a rollback and a public-origin check, and PIG_IMAGE now reaches compose through `sudo env`, without which sudo's env_reset silently resolved every release to pig:local.
